How do you calculate if the annual fee is worth the financial return?
Many consumers make the mistake of ignoring the cost of the annual fee when they are seduced by promises of cashback, which can result in a net financial loss at the end of the year.
The mathematical calculation should subtract the total annual cost from the estimated annual cashback value, considering your historical average of monthly spending, to obtain a realistic result regarding the product's viability.
If the card charges R$ 600.00 in annual fees and offers 1% in return, you would need to spend at least R$ 60,000.00 annually just to reach the break-even point, without generating any real profit.
Experts recommend prioritizing cards that offer annual fee waivers for spending or investments, ensuring that every penny returned is actually an additional gain and not just a discount on the fee.
Always check the fine print, as certain establishments may be excluded from cashback calculations, such as bill payments, taxes, or mobile phone top-ups, depending on the specific rules of the bank contract.

Which banks offer the highest cashback percentage?
The updated 2026 ranking shows a fierce competition between digital banks and credit unions, which are able to operate with lower margins and pass on more benefits to their members and loyal customers.
Nubank, through its UltraVioleta level, offers 1% which yields 200% of the CDI rate, making it one of the most profitable options for those who do not intend to use the money immediately to pay off their monthly bill.
Institutions like Nomad and Avenue have also made a strong entry into the global card segment, offering cashback in dollars for international purchases, an excellent strategy for frequent travelers or shoppers from foreign websites.

Comparative Benefits Table (Data 2026)
| Card | Cashback Base | Exemption Requirement | Differential |
| Inter Black | 1,2% | R$ 7k spent or R$ 50k invested | Directly into the checking account. |
| XP Visa Infinite | 1,0% | R$ 3k spent or R$ 5k invested | Automatic Investback |
| Nubank UV | 1,0% | R$ 5k spent or R$ 50k invested | CDI yields 200% |
| BTG Black | Up to 1.0% | For expenses or investments | Full modularity |
| Amazon Prime | 2% to 5% | Free for Prime subscribers. | Focused on internal purchases |
How to maximize earnings with loyalty programs?

True financial intelligence lies in "stacking" benefits, using cashback cards in conjunction with shopping portals that also offer cashback, such as Méliuz or Cuponomia.
When making an online purchase, you can receive 1% from your card and an additional 5% from the retail partner, totaling significant savings that, accumulated monthly, represent a relevant portion of your income.
Keep an eye out for seasonal promotions where cashback is doubled in certain categories, such as pharmacies, gas stations, or supermarkets, adjusting your spending habits to take advantage of these profitability peaks.
Another advanced strategy is to use the Cashback cards 2026 to consolidate all fixed household expenses, from electricity to streaming services, maximizing the total volume transacted monthly by the account holder.
Avoid excessive installment payments if this compromises your ability to pay, as revolving credit interest negates any cashback benefits, turning what would be an advantage into a dangerous debt.
When should you choose miles instead of cash back?
The decision between accumulating airline miles or preferring to have the money in your account depends entirely on your travel plans and the value you place on miles in the current secondary market.
For those who travel at least twice a year, miles often offer a higher redemption value than cashback, especially for business class tickets or during peak season.
However, for consumers who prefer liquidity and complete freedom to spend wherever they want, cashback is unbeatable due to its simplicity and the absence of expiration dates common with points programs.
Consider whether you have the patience to monitor bonus transfers, because without them, accumulating miles may be less advantageous than a solid 1% cashback deposited directly into your account.

FAQ (Frequently Asked Questions)
Is cashback received on a credit card taxable?
Currently, cashback is considered a commercial discount and not income; therefore, there is no income tax levied on amounts received by individuals.
How long does it take for the refund to appear in my account?
The timeframe varies depending on the bank; some credit the amount immediately after purchase confirmation, while others process the transaction and credit only after the invoice is paid.
Could I lose my accumulated cashback?
Yes, in cases of default or cancellation of the card before redemption, institutions may retain the funds. Always read the terms and conditions to understand the expiration and loss clauses.
Is it worth having more than one cashback card?
Generally, it's best to concentrate spending on a single card to reach the annual fee waiver thresholds and maximize the return volume in one place.
